The stuff is probably some type of steptic in a spray form. Will cauterize any bleeding and just allow to heal. Could also be similar to the silver nitrate we put on burn victims... Either way, you won't likey hurt her with any of these things. All these topical type over the counter stuff are all benign, anything metal based has natual anti-bacterial properties. Having said that, don't go rubbing shop goo on her leg She will heal quickly and you will be good to go soon enough!
